K~+,Yb~(3+):BaWO_4晶体光谱性能研究

Keywords: 熔体中晶体生长,钡化合物,荧光

Full-Text   Cite this paper   Add to My Lib

Abstract:

为提高Yb~(3+)离子在BaWO_4晶体中的掺入量,采用了双掺K~+离子的方法,增大Yb~(3+)离子的分凝系数,使K~+(x(K~+)=0.01),Yb~(3+)(x(Yb~(3+))=0.02):BaWO_4晶体在977nm处的吸收系数达到α=0.494cm~(-1).研究了波长为930nm的LD激光抽运时相应于Yb~(3+)离子~2F_(5/2)→~2F_(7/2)跃迁的960~1020nm的荧光光谱,其在1005nm处的发射截面σ_(?)=6.286pm~2,荧光寿命为0.4ms.实验表明K~+,Yb~(3+):BaWO_4是一种新型近红外激光晶体。
